Volleyball Preview: Duchesne Eagles vs. North Sevier Wolves
Duchesne is 2-8 against North Sevier since September of 2021 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Thursday. The Eagles are taking a road trip to challenge the Wolves at 7:00 p.m. Both come into the contest b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
On Tuesday, Duchesne earned a 3-1 win over South Summit.
Duchesne had a slow start but a hot finish: after dropping the first set, they turned around to win the next three. The match finished with set scores of 18-25, 28-26, 25-22, 25-13.
Meanwhile, in Tuesday's Canine Competition, North Sevier prevailed. They put the hurt on Gunnison Valley with a sharp 3-0 victory on Tuesday. The win continues a trend for the Wolves in their matchups with the Bulldogs: they've now won eight in a row.
The victory didn't come easy: Gunnison Valley scored at least 18 points in every set. The final score came out to 25-19, 25-18, 25-21.
Duchesne's record is now 12-5. As for North Sevier, their record now sits at 9-11.
Duchesne beat North Sevier 3-1 in their previous meeting back in September. The rematch might be a little tougher for the Eagles since the squad won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
